Can the v8 pre-defined ops be called as a kfunc? The qdisc_watchdog_cancel/init in v9 could be a kfunc and called by pro/epilogue. For checking and/or resetting skb->dev, it should be simple enough without kfunc. e.g. when reusing the skb->rbnode in the future followup effort. [ Unrelated to qdisc. bpf_tcp_ca can also use help to ensure the cwnd is sane. ] > > Maybe we can keep the current approach in the initial version as they > are not in the fast path, and then move to (gen_prologue, > gen_epilogue) once the plumbing is done? Sure. It can be improved when things are ready. I am trying some ideas on how to do gen_epilogue and will share when I get some tests working.
